Columbia Valley RCMP Report

By Sgt. Ed deJong

This past week, June 24 to July 1, Columbia Valley RCMP responded to 88 calls for service. The following is a summary of some of the files our officers responded to.

Grossly intoxicated individual removed from road

On June 26, police received a call of a male staggering to his vehicle and getting in the driverā€™s seat. Police responded and conducted patrols, locating the vehicle a short time later. The driver was spoken to and detained for an impaired driving investigation. The driver provided two samples of his breath confirming he was grossly intoxicated by alcohol.Ā  Impaired driving charges have been forwarded to Crown for approval.

Cement truck rollover in Fairmont

On June 27, Columbia Valley RCMP responded to a cement truck rollover at the intersection of Highway 93/95 and Fairmont Resort Road.Ā  The loaded truck failed to negotiate the turn and flipped on its side. The driver was taken to East Kootenay Regional Hospital in Cranbrook with a possible concussion. The investigation is continuing.
